Challenge
The European Central Bank (ECB) is undertaking a major transformation to redefine its working environment and adapt to mobile and hybrid working models. By consolidating operations from three buildings into two and redesigning workspaces to be more flexible and collaborative, the project will impact approximately 5,000 staff members.
Our approach
Working closely with the ECB’s internal teams, including the spatial transformation and change management teams, we combine bespoke analysis with proactive stakeholder engagement, supported by a network of change agents who work closely with leaders and staff to embed new ways of working across the organisation.
Generated impact
The ECB is driving a cultural and operational transformation across all business areas, supported by a network of change agents who work closely with leaders and teams to embed new ways of working and foster innovation. This approach is reducing resistance, building commitment and promoting collaboration. Whilst the project is ongoing, the final business areas are expected to transition by mid-2028.
